Bulinus globosus (Planorbidae; Gastropoda) populations in the Lake Victoria basin and coastal Kenya show extreme nuclear genetic differentiation.
Acta tropica - 1 Nov 2013
Nyakaana Silvester, Stothard J Russell, Nalugwa Allen, Webster Bonnie L, Lange Charles N, Jørgensen Aslak, Rollinson David, Kristensen Thomas K
Abstract excerpt
Bulinus globosus, a key intermediate host for Schistosoma haematobium that causes urinary schistosomiasis, is a hermaphroditic freshwater Planorbid snail species that inhabits patchy and transient water bodies prone to large seasonal variations in water availability. Although capable of self-fertilizing, this species has been reported to be preferentially out crossing. In this study, we characterized the...
